ansible/roles/music/handlers/main.yaml

28 lines
531 B
YAML

---
- name: reload nginx
systemd:
name: nginx
state: reloaded
- name: rebuild trollibox
command: ./build.sh
args:
chdir: /opt/trollibox
environment: { RELEASE: 1 }
- name: restart trollibox
systemd:
name: trollibox
state: restarted
daemon_reload: true
- name: rebuild librespot
command: /root/.cargo/bin/cargo build --release --features jackaudio-backend
args:
chdir: /opt/librespot
- name: restart librespot
systemd:
name: librespot
state: restarted
daemon_reload: true